The VDSL splitter board is divided according to the number of access users and can be divided into two categories: 24 channels, 48/64 channels:
The 24-way splitter board is used together with the 24-way VDSL2 service board.
The 48 / 64-channel splitter board is used together with the 48 / 64-channel VDSL2 service board.
Differences Between 24-channel VDSL SPL Boards
Board | Port Impedance | Applicable Line | Applicable Service Board |
H801VSTL | Complex impedance (ETSI TS 101 952 01 01 option A) | POTS | 24-port VDSL2 over POTS Service Board |
H801VSTH | Complex impedance (2B1Q or 4B3T) | ISDN | 24-port VDSL2 over ISDN Service Board |
Differences Between 48/64-channel VDSL SPL Boards
Board | Port Quantity | Port Impedance | Applicable Line | Applicable Service Board |
H801VSNF | 48 | 600-ohm impedance | POTS | 48-port VDSL2 over POTS Service Board |
H801VSNLA | 48 | Complex impedance (ETSI TS 101 952 01 01 option A) | POTS | 48-port VDSL2 over POTS Service Board |
H801VSPHA | 64 | 2B1Q or 4B3T | ISDN | 48/64-port VDSL2 over ISDN Service Board |
H801VSPLA | 64 | Complex impedance (ETSI TS 101 952 01 01 option A) | POTS | 64-port VDSL2 over POTS Service Board |
H801VSPLC | 64 | Complex impedance (ETSI TS 101 952 01 01 option B) | POTS | 64-port VDSL2 over POTS Service Board |
